Job Summary

KDCI Outsourcing is seeking a Digital Content Quality & Compliance Specialist to support daily compliance operations across our digital content and monetization programs. This role is responsible for enforcing policies, conducting quality checks, and identifying risks to ensure all content meets internal standards and client requirements. The position requires strong attention to detail, consistent accuracy, and the ability to work efficiently in a fast-paced environment while supporting cross-functional teams.


Key Responsibilities

Policy Enforcement and Audits

  • Monitor and manage compliance flags within the Google Policy Center to ensure adherence to monetization and content policies.
  • Conduct quality assessments for various campaign types (e.g., display, download intent, installer formats).
  • Review, track, and document non-compliant programs in the catalog on a regular basis.

Regulatory and Legal Compliance

  • Support antivirus (AV) compliance by tracking warnings and managing blocked program listings.
  • Assist in processing DMCA notices and ensure timely handling of related compliance tasks.

Process and Policy Development

  • Collaborate with Legal and Compliance teams to update guidelines and operational standards for new content verticals (e.g., push notifications, installer formats).
  • Ensure that updates are correctly implemented and consistently applied across white-label products.

Collaboration and Reporting

  • Work efficiently with internal teams using project management tools such as Jira or Asana for tracking, visibility, and alignment.
  • Prepare basic compliance activity reports, tracking sheets, and summary updates for management as needed.


Job Requirements

  • Minimum of 1 year experience in compliance, quality assurance, or risk management—preferably in digital media, advertising, or technology sectors.
  • Basic understanding of Google’s monetization and compliance policies and related industry standards.
  • Strong attention to detail with excellent analytical and problem-solving skills.
  • Ability to interpret guidelines, assess risks, and identify non-compliant items.
  • Familiarity or interest in automation tools, AI-driven workflows, or quality control systems.
  • Strong written and verbal English communication skills; able to collaborate with cross-functional and client-facing teams.
  • Proactive, reliable, ethical, and dedicated to maintaining high compliance and quality standards.
  • Nice to Have: Compliance-related certifications such as CCEP.
